Melbourne Knights striker Caleb Mikulic has signed with Jimmy Jeggo's new Austrian club Austria Vienna.
The forward rejoined the Knights in December after a brief stint with St Albans Saints.
Mikulic scored one goal in three appearances for the Knights this season.
The 20-year-old came through the club's youth ranks and broke into the NPL Victoria in 2016.
"Ever since I was a boy playing soccer I’ve always wanted to become a professional player and with some hard work and perseverance, I have the opportunity to make my dream come true," Mikulic told the Knights website.
“For me personally this is my first stepping stone to become the professional footballer I would like to be.
"Hopefully it opens more windows of opportunity for the future.
"Thanks to the Melbourne Knights community for all their support and well wishes, I hope I can make us all proud.
"I couldn’t be happier signing with a club like FK Austria Wien. The club’s professionalism and standards are above expectations."
He will be joined by fellow Australian Jimmy Jeggo who has transferred from Sturm Graz late last week.
